Abstract

A heat-assisted magnetic recording medium includes a substrate, an underlayer, and a magnetic layer including an alloy having a L1crystal structure and first and second layers, arranged in this order. Each of the first and second layers has a granular structure including C, SiO, and BN at grain boundaries. Vol % of the grain boundaries in each of the first and second layers is 25 to 45 vol %. Vol % of C in the first layer is 5 to 22 vol %, and a volume ratio of SiOwith respect to BN in each of the first and second layers is 0.25 to 3.5. Vol % of SiOin the second layer is greater than that of the first layer by 5 vol % or more. Vol % of BN in the second layer is smaller than that in the first layer by 2 vol % or more.
